Summary
Poet John Wakeman told The Irish Times that he thought "it would be exciting to start a poetry magazine out of the wilds of West Cork in Ireland." Within a few years THE SHOp became one of Ireland<U+2019>s most highly-regarded poetry magazines, not only for its contents but for its looks. "Unquestionably the most beautiful poetry magazine now in existence," Bernard O<U+2019>Donoghue said. Seamus Heaney described himself as a "confirmed SHOp-lifter."
